2025-06-01 | Game Summary

In an uneventful MLS match at Toyota Stadium on May 31, 2025, FC Dallas and Philadelphia Union played to a 0-0 draw. Philadelphia Union dominated possession with 68.4%, unleashing 23 total shots, but only one found the target. FC Dallas, playing a 4-2-3-1 formation, struggled to maintain possession, managing only 7 shots with 2 on target. A significant moment occurred in the 39th minute when Lalas Abubakar of FC Dallas received a red card, forcing them to play with ten men for over half the match. Despite the numerical advantage, Philadelphia Union's 4-4-2 formation failed to capitalize and convert their dominance into goals. FC Dallas has been struggling recently, with multiple draws and a loss in their last few MLS games, compounded by a red card in a recent U.S. Open Cup match. Their next game is away against Sporting Kansas City, a team that is also currently struggling to secure wins. Philadelphia Union, on the other hand, has been in decent form, securing multiple wins recently. They will face Charlotte FC in their next match. In previous encounters, head-to-head games between Philadelphia and FC Dallas have been closely contested, with Philadelphia having a slight advantage.
